AI PRODUCT ENGINEER (LLM-FIRST FULL-STACK)
Location: Remote (except California) | Status: Full-Time
At Marketing Architects, we believe TV advertising is still the most powerful marketing channel. Today, we are growing a team of talent from across the United States to reimagine how brands advertise on TV.
You'll ship production features fast by pairing deep engineering fundamentals with AI-assisted development. You'll compose services, generate code responsibly, write tests, and stand up evaluation harnesses so quality, cost, and latency are visible and improving week over week.
Marketing Architects is an All-Inclusive TV agency that gives performance brands access to high-quality, effective TV campaigns without the traditional high entry cost and ongoing challenges of optimization, scale, and measurement. Founded in Minneapolis, Marketing Architects has been helping companies connect with their customers in new and inspiring ways for more than 25 years.
